InputGroup doc added
parent
93c7f113b7
commit
d1fca6b675
|
@ -110,10 +110,14 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
<InputGroupDoc/>
|
||||||
</div>
|
</div>
|
||||||
</template>
|
</template>
|
||||||
|
|
||||||
<script>
|
<script>
|
||||||
|
import InputGroupDoc from './InputGroupDoc';
|
||||||
|
|
||||||
export default {
|
export default {
|
||||||
data() {
|
data() {
|
||||||
return {
|
return {
|
||||||
|
@ -122,6 +126,9 @@ export default {
|
||||||
radioValue1: '',
|
radioValue1: '',
|
||||||
radioValue2: ''
|
radioValue2: ''
|
||||||
}
|
}
|
||||||
|
},
|
||||||
|
components: {
|
||||||
|
'InputGroupDoc': InputGroupDoc
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
|
|
|
@ -0,0 +1,142 @@
|
||||||
|
<template>
|
||||||
|
<div class="content-section documentation">
|
||||||
|
<TabView>
|
||||||
|
<TabPanel header="Source">
|
||||||
|
<a href="https://github.com/primefaces/primevue/tree/master/src/views/inputgroup" class="btn-viewsource" target="_blank" rel="noopener noreferrer">
|
||||||
|
<span>View on GitHub</span>
|
||||||
|
</a>
|
||||||
|
<CodeHighlight>
|
||||||
|
<template v-pre>
|
||||||
|
<template>
|
||||||
|
<div>
|
||||||
|
<div class="content-section introduction">
|
||||||
|
<div class="feature-intro">
|
||||||
|
<h1>InputGroup</h1>
|
||||||
|
<p>Text, icon, buttons and other content can be grouped next to an input.</p>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="content-section implementation">
|
||||||
|
<h3 class="first">Addons</h3>
|
||||||
|
<div class="p-grid p-fluid">
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<i class="pi pi-user"></i>
|
||||||
|
</span>
|
||||||
|
<InputText placeholder="Username" />
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">$</span>
|
||||||
|
<InputText placeholder="Price" />
|
||||||
|
<span class="p-inputgroup-addon">.00</span>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">W</span>
|
||||||
|
<InputText placeholder="Website" />
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<h3>Multiple Addons</h3>
|
||||||
|
<div class="p-grid">
|
||||||
|
<div class="p-col-12">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<i class="pi pi-clock"></i>
|
||||||
|
</span>
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<i class="pi pi-star"></i>
|
||||||
|
</span>
|
||||||
|
<InputText placeholder="Price" />
|
||||||
|
<span class="p-inputgroup-addon">$</span>
|
||||||
|
<span class="p-inputgroup-addon">.00</span>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<h3>Button Addons</h3>
|
||||||
|
<div class="p-grid p-fluid">
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<Button label="Search"/>
|
||||||
|
<InputText placeholder="Keyword"/>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<InputText placeholder="Keyword"/>
|
||||||
|
<Button icon="pi pi-search" class="p-button-warning"/>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<Button icon="pi pi-check" class="p-button-success"/>
|
||||||
|
<InputText placeholder="Vote"/>
|
||||||
|
<Button icon="pi pi-times" class="p-button-danger"/>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<h3>Checkbox and RadioButton</h3>
|
||||||
|
<div class="p-grid p-fluid">
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<Checkbox v-model="checked1" />
|
||||||
|
</span>
|
||||||
|
<InputText placeholder="Username"/>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<InputText placeholder="Price"/>
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<RadioButton name="rb1" value="rb1" v-model="radioValue1" />
|
||||||
|
</span>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
|
||||||
|
<div class="p-col-12 p-md-4">
|
||||||
|
<div class="p-inputgroup">
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<Checkbox v-model="checked2" />
|
||||||
|
</span>
|
||||||
|
<InputText placeholder="Website"/>
|
||||||
|
<span class="p-inputgroup-addon">
|
||||||
|
<RadioButton name="rb2" value="rb2" v-model="radioValue2" />
|
||||||
|
</span>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</template>
|
||||||
|
</template>
|
||||||
|
</CodeHighlight>
|
||||||
|
|
||||||
|
<CodeHighlight lang="javascript">
|
||||||
|
export default {
|
||||||
|
data() {
|
||||||
|
return {
|
||||||
|
checked1: false,
|
||||||
|
checked2: false,
|
||||||
|
radioValue1: '',
|
||||||
|
radioValue2: ''
|
||||||
|
}
|
||||||
|
}
|
||||||
|
}
|
||||||
|
</CodeHighlight>
|
||||||
|
</TabPanel>
|
||||||
|
</TabView>
|
||||||
|
</div>
|
||||||
|
</template>
|
Loading…
Reference in New Issue